    I'd like a specific set of selected cells to return a specific cell - all text or x

    There are 12 possible options in my excel, and I'd like a different combination of them to result in a specific answer (different answer for each combination). I've tried IF THEN and conditional formatting, but nothing I know works. I do very little with functions, but get the general/basic stuff.

    Life stress high or low
    Life stress high
    life stress low
    Trauma high or low
    trauma high
    trauma low


    And others - so, if someone is experiencing (4 options will be selected) they would do....this is the result I want. There are 7 possible results that can come from the various experiences.

    Since you are open to different options, I'm uploading my interpretation. I would use helper columns. I'm assuming that one patient will be done at a time and assigning a score to the options of Life Stressors, Trauma, SUDS and Mental health. Then a lookup column with the optional outcomes possible and a formula looking up the sum for each patient and their outcomes. There is one outcome for each patient, I put in pt A as the example (all in the results tab). If you change the levels in C2 through C5 you'll see different results populate in for each option.

    EDIT: my assumption is that you only need one outcome per patient. You can do multiple patients in the same worksheet, you just need to adjust the sumif ranges but you can keep the same lookup table.

    You're very welcome, AND thank you for the rep!

    You might also want to note that I used odd sets of numbers in column A and the lookups in column J. This is because if I used simple numbers like 1,2,3 and 4 combinations of them would end up causing errors for the lookups, for example 1 plus 2 would be equal to 3 so the lookup would go to the first 3 value in column J SUD counseling and ignore the community referral for life stressors and trauma. That is why you'll see that the numbers are oddly sporadic, so none of them when added together will equal any of the others either individually or when added.

    I tested every combo I thought of but missed that one. So in D2 change the vlookup to this...
    =VLOOKUP(SUMIF($C$2:$C$5,"Hi",$A$2:$A$5),$J$2:$K$17,2,FALSE)
    in J16 add this =a3+a5 and in J17 add this =a2+a3+a5
    in K16 add this Mental Health and Trauma Counseling
    and in K17 add this Community Referral and Trauma and Mental Health Counseling
    the new range for the vlookup will cover those additional rows in J and K. You should be fine with that.
    if it occurs again, just add another to the list, like I wrote, I thought (hoped) I accounted for each combination.
